Just outside of Minneapolis and St. Paul is Hutchinson, Minnesota – where Hutchinson High School is located.

Hutchinson High School is also an alma mater of Lindsay Whalen, four-time WNBA champion with the Minnesota Lynx and current head coach of the women’s basketball program at the University of Minnesota.

The school board at Hutchinson has resolved to rename the indoor gymnasium after Whalen.

She led her school to three conference championships, is the HHS all-time leading scorer, and had her No. 13 jersey retired at the school. Whalen also participated in other sports while at Hutchinson.

A public ceremony will be on Nov. 27 at the Hutchinson High School gymnasium.
